"O knower of dharma, if you are bent
on dharma and desire to practise dharma,
stay here and serve me; performs the
supreme dharma.
 
शुश्रूषुर्जननीं पुत्र स्वगृहे नियतो वसन् ।
परेण तपसा युक्तः काश्यपस्त्रिदिवं गतः ॥
 
O son, serving his mother, living in his
own house with self-restraint and practis-
ing the highest penance, Kasyapa attained
heaven.
 
यथैव राजा पूज्यस्ते गौरवेण तथा ह्यहम् ।
त्वां नाहमनुजानामि न गन्तव्यमितो वनम् ॥
 
As the king is to be honoured by you
with due regard, so should I be. I do not
grant permission. Therefore you should
not go from here to the forest.
 
त्वद्वियोगान्न मे कार्य जीवितेन सुखेन वा ।
त्वया सह मम श्रेयस्तृणानामपि भक्षणम् ॥
 
Without you, life and comfort are no
use to me. With you, it is preferable to
me even to live on grass.".
